In the shower, rinsing off the previous evening's 
American hypocrisy and rhetoric -- mental grime.

The radio is on, NPR is talking 
about a school.  A school with 

no drama, 
no music, 
no art.

The students read a language they don't understand;
They fake understanding with rote memorization, 

slip
through
the
cracks

I grab the shampoo, think good thoughts about myself.
"This is why I'm an educator, so that I can stop this from
happening."

The report goes on.

They brutalize and kill students who might be homosexual.
They present opinions about other countries in educational settings
as statements of fact.
They bring media into the classroom that espouse cultural and moral
values that diminish the possibility of open discourse.

I grab the soap, think good thoughts about myself.
"This is why I'm an educator."

Then the host asks the guest if he noticed anything else on his trip
to an Afghani madrasa.

With horror, I frantically grab at the shampoo again.
Not even safe in the shower.  Hypocrisy is everywhere.
